The Element of Suspense

One of the key attractions of mystery books is the element of suspense. From the very first page, readers are drawn into a world where the answers to puzzling questions are just out of reach. As the story unfolds, clues are revealed, suspects emerge, and the tension builds, keeping readers on the edge of their seats. Whether it's a locked room mystery or a complex conspiracy, the suspense keeps readers guessing until the very end.

Complex Characters

Another reason why mystery books are so captivating is the complex and often flawed characters that populate them. Detectives, amateur sleuths, and suspects alike are often portrayed with depth and nuance, making them more relatable and engaging. Readers are drawn to these characters, rooting for them to solve the case while also understanding their personal struggles and motivations.

Clever Plot Twists

One of the hallmarks of a great mystery book is a clever plot twist that keeps readers guessing. Whether it's a sudden revelation that turns the case on its head or a surprising reveal that changes everything, a well-executed plot twist can elevate a mystery book from good to great. These twists challenge readers' assumptions and keep them engaged until the very last page.

The Joy of Solving the Puzzle

One of the most satisfying aspects of reading a mystery book is the joy of solving the puzzle along with the detective or sleuth. As clues are uncovered and suspects are questioned, readers can try to piece together the mystery themselves, testing their own powers of deduction against those of the protagonist. This interactive element of mystery books makes them especially rewarding for readers who enjoy a challenge.

Escapism and Entertainment

In addition to their intellectual appeal, mystery books also offer readers a form of escapism and entertainment. The thrill of solving a mystery vicariously through the characters can be incredibly satisfying, providing a temporary escape from the stresses of everyday life. Whether it's a cozy mystery set in a quaint village or a gritty noir thriller set in a gritty urban landscape, mystery books offer a diverse range of settings and scenarios that can transport readers to another world.
